"content": " Yes, Hon. Speaker. On Monday this week, there was a big demonstration by the people of Narok in Narok Town. This was not only a demonstration of the ordinary people but also the rich farmers of Narok. They are the main people who farm wheat in Narok. The reason is that wheat is full to the brim in the stores of Narok and there is nowhere to sell it. Narok has always been the main area, apart from Uasin Gishu, where wheat farming takes place in Kenya. Because of some reasons, there is a clog somewhere. The wheat in Narok cannot be sold anywhere. It is important for this Statement to make the matter very clear. There are allegations that we are not selling our wheat because we are importing it. This causes lack of market for our wheat. The Cabinet Secretary must tell us if this is a fact. If so, then the Government must buy this wheat and pay the farmers, so that they can continue to farm. Otherwise, next year, we will still continue to import wheat. Hon. Speaker, I support the Request for Statement."
